Kerawahi
Kerawahi is a village located in Makdi tehsil of Bastar district in Chhattisgarh, India. It is situated 30km away from sub-district headquarter Makdi (tehsildar office) and 90km away from district headquarter Jagdalpur. As per 2009 stats, Kerawahi village is also a gram panchayat.

About Kerawahi
According to Census 2011, the location code or village code of Kerawahi is 448888. The village spans a total geographical area of 1338.15 hectares, and the pincode of the locality is 494229. Kondagaon is nearest town to Kerawahi village for all major economic activities, which is approximately 10km away.

Population of Kerawahi
Below is a concise population overview of Kerawahi as per the Census 2011 data. The table highlights the key population metrics categorized by gender and social groups.
Particulars | Total | Male | Female |
---|---|---|---|
Total Population | 2,467 | 1,207 | 1,260 |
Child Population (0–6 yrs) | 374 | 179 | 195 |
Scheduled Castes (SC) | N/A | N/A | N/A |
Scheduled Tribes (ST) | 1,818 | 881 | 937 |
Literate Population | 1,128 | 703 | 425 |
Illiterate Population | 1,339 | 504 | 835 |
Here's a detailed summary of the Basic Population Details of Kerawahi village:
- The total population of Kerawahi village is around 2,467, including approximately 1,207 males and 1,260 females, with a sex ratio of 1043 females per 1,000 males.
- There are about 374 children aged 0–6 years in Kerawahi village, reflecting the young population in the village.
- Kerawahi village has 1,818 residents from the Scheduled Tribes (ST).
- The literacy rate of Kerawahi village is about 45.72%, with male literacy at 58.24% and female literacy at 33.73%.
- There are around 512 households in Kerawahi village.
Connectivity of Kerawahi
Connectivity plays a major role in improving access, opportunities, and overall development of villages like Kerawahi. As per the 2011 stats, Kerawahi had access to public bus service, private bus service and railway station.
Connectivity Type | Status (in year 2011) |
---|---|
Public Bus Service | Available |
Private Bus Service | Available within village |
Railway Station | Available within 10+ km distance |
